INSTRUCTION FOR MEDICAL USE OF THE MEDICINAL PRODUCT TELNOR (TELNOR)
Composition:
Active substance: telmisartan;
One tablet contains telmisartan 20 mg or 40 mg or 80 mg;
Excipients: meglumine, mannitol, sodium hydroxide, magnesium stearate.
Pharmaceutical form. Tablets.
Main physicochemical properties:
20 mg tablets: round, flat with beveled edges, white to almost white tablets, with the inscription "H" on one side and "162" on the reverse side;
40 mg tablets: oval, biconvex tablets, white to almost white, with the inscription "H" on one side and "163" on the reverse side;
80 mg tablets: oval, biconvex tablets, white to almost white, with the inscription "H" on one side and "164" on the reverse side.
Pharmacotherapeutic group. Simple preparations of angiotensin II antagonists.
ATC code C09CA07.
Pharmacological Properties.
Pharmacodynamics.
Mechanism of Action.

Clinical characteristics.
Indications.
Hypertension.
Treatment of essential hypertension in adults.
Prevention of cardiovascular diseases.
Reduction of cardiovascular morbidity in patients with:
- Manifest atherothrombotic cardiovascular disease (history of ischemic heart disease, stroke, or peripheral arterial disease);
- Type 2 diabetes mellitus with documented target organ damage.
Contraindications.
- Hypersensitivity to the active substance or to any of the excipients of the drug;
- Pregnancy or women planning to become pregnant (see sections "Special precautions for use", "Use during pregnancy or breastfeeding");
- Biliary obstruction;
- Severe hepatic impairment;
- Pediatric population (under 18 years of age).
Concomitant use of telmisartan and aliskiren-containing medicinal products is contraindicated in patients with diabetes mellitus or renal impairment (GFR < 60 mL/min/1.73 m²) (see sections "Interaction with other medicinal products and other forms of interaction" and "Pharmacological properties").
Interaction with other medicinal products and other forms of interaction.
Digoxin
When telmisartan and digoxin are used concomitantly, mean increases in digoxin peak plasma concentrations (by 49%) and trough concentrations (by 20%) have been observed. Monitoring of digoxin levels should be performed at the beginning of treatment, during dose adjustments, and upon discontinuation of telmisartan to maintain levels within the therapeutic range.
As with other agents that inhibit the renin-angiotensin-aldosterone system (RAAS), telmisartan may cause hyperkalemia (see section "Special precautions for use"). The risk may be increased when used concomitantly with other agents that may also cause hyperkalemia (potassium-containing salt substitutes, potassium-sparing diuretics, angiotensin-converting enzyme inhibitors, angiotensin II receptor antagonists, nonsteroidal anti-inflammatory drugs (NSAIDs, including selective COX-2 inhibitors), heparin, immunosuppressants (cyclosporine or tacrolimus), and trimethoprim).
Cases of hyperkalemia depend on associated risk factors. The risk increases with the above-mentioned therapeutic combinations. The risk is particularly high when combined with potassium-sparing diuretics and with potassium-containing salt substitutes. Combination with ACE inhibitors or NSAIDs is less risky provided that appropriate precautions are strictly observed.
Concomitant use is not recommended.
Potassium-sparing diuretics or potassium supplements. Angiotensin II receptor antagonists such as telmisartan reduce potassium loss induced by diuretics. Potassium-sparing diuretics (e.g., spironolactone, eplerenone, triamterene, or amiloride), potassium-containing dietary supplements, or potassium-containing salt substitutes may lead to a significant increase in serum potassium concentration. If concomitant use is indicated due to documented hypokalemia, they should be used with caution and serum potassium levels should be monitored frequently.
Lithium. Increases in serum lithium concentrations and lithium toxicity have been reported during concomitant use of lithium with ACE inhibitors and angiotensin II receptor antagonists, including telmisartan. These effects are generally reversible. If concomitant use is necessary, careful monitoring of serum lithium levels is recommended.
Concomitant use requires caution.
Nonsteroidal anti-inflammatory drugs (NSAIDs). NSAIDs (i.e., acetylsalicylic acid at anti-inflammatory doses, COX-2 inhibitors, and non-selective NSAIDs) may reduce the antihypertensive effect of angiotensin II receptor antagonists.
In some patients with impaired renal function (e.g., dehydrated patients or elderly patients with renal impairment), concomitant use of angiotensin II receptor antagonists and agents that inhibit cyclooxygenase may lead to further deterioration of renal function, including possible acute renal failure, which is usually reversible. Therefore, such combinations should be used with caution, especially in elderly patients. Patients should receive adequate fluid intake, and consideration should be given to monitoring renal function after initiation and periodically after discontinuation of concomitant therapy.
In one study, concomitant administration of telmisartan and ramipril resulted in a 2.5-fold increase in AUC₀–₂₄ and Cₘₐₓ for ramipril and ramiprilat. The clinical significance of this phenomenon is unknown.
Diuretics (thiazide or loop diuretics). Prior treatment with high doses of diuretics such as furosemide (a loop diuretic) or hydrochlorothiazide (a thiazide diuretic) may lead to dehydration and an increased risk of developing arterial hypotension at the start of telmisartan therapy.
Should be considered during concomitant use.
Other antihypertensive agents. The ability of telmisartan to lower blood pressure may be enhanced by concomitant use of other antihypertensive agents.
Clinical data have shown that dual blockade of the renin-angiotensin-aldosterone system (RAAS) by combining ACE inhibitors, angiotensin II receptor blockers, or aliskiren is associated with a higher incidence of adverse effects such as arterial hypotension, hyperkalemia, and decreased renal function (including acute renal failure) compared to use of a single RAAS-acting agent (see sections "Special precautions for use", "Contraindications", and "Pharmacodynamics").
Due to the pharmacological properties of baclofen and amifostine, it can be expected that these medicinal products may enhance the hypotensive effect of all antihypertensive agents, including telmisartan. Additionally, orthostatic hypotension may be exacerbated by alcohol consumption, barbiturates, narcotics, and antidepressants.
Corticosteroids (systemic use). Reduction of antihypertensive effect.
Special precautions for use.
Pregnancy. Angiotensin II receptor antagonists must not be initiated during pregnancy. If continuation of angiotensin II receptor antagonists is not considered essential in a woman planning pregnancy, she should be switched to an alternative antihypertensive therapy with an established safety profile during pregnancy. Angiotensin II receptor antagonists must be discontinued immediately upon confirmation of pregnancy, and alternative treatment should be initiated if necessary (see sections "Contraindications" and "Use during pregnancy or breastfeeding").
Hepatic impairment. Telmisartan is contraindicated in patients with cholestasis, biliary obstruction, or severe hepatic impairment (see section "Contraindications"), as telmisartan is primarily excreted via bile. Hepatic clearance of telmisartan is reduced in patients with these conditions.
Telmsartan should be used with caution in patients with mild to moderate hepatic impairment.
Renovascular hypertension. There is an increased risk of severe hypotension and renal failure in patients with bilateral renal artery stenosis or stenosis of the artery to a single functioning kidney when treated with drugs affecting the renin-angiotensin-aldosterone system (RAAS).
Renal impairment and kidney transplantation. Periodic monitoring of serum potassium and creatinine levels is recommended in patients with impaired renal function receiving telmisartan. There is no experience with the use of telmisartan in patients who have recently undergone kidney transplantation.
Reduced intravascular fluid volume. Symptomatic hypotension, particularly after the first dose of telmisartan, may occur in patients with reduced intravascular volume and/or reduced sodium levels due to intensive diuretic therapy, a low-salt diet, or diarrhoea and vomiting. These conditions should be corrected before administering telmisartan. Sodium levels and/or intravascular fluid volume should be normalized prior to initiating telmisartan therapy.
Dual blockade of the renin-angiotensin-aldosterone system (RAAS).
Evidence indicates that concomitant use of angiotensin-converting enzyme (ACE) inhibitors, angiotensin II receptor blockers, or aliskiren increases the risk of hypotension, hyperkalaemia, and reduced renal function (including acute renal failure).
Therefore, dual blockade by combining ACE inhibitors, angiotensin II receptor blockers, or aliskiren is not recommended (see sections "Interaction with other medicinal products and other forms of interaction" and "Pharmacodynamics").
If dual blockade is considered absolutely necessary, it should be performed only under specialist supervision and with continuous, careful monitoring of renal function, electrolytes, and blood pressure.
ACE inhibitors and angiotensin II receptor blockers should not be used concomitantly in patients with diabetic nephropathy.
Other conditions requiring RAAS activity.
In patients whose vascular tone and renal function primarily depend on RAAS activity (e.g., patients with severe congestive heart failure or significant renal disease, including renal artery stenosis), treatment with telmisartan and other drugs affecting the RAAS may lead to acute hypotension, hyperazotemia, oliguria, and rarely, acute renal failure (see section "Adverse reactions").
Primary hyperaldosteronism. Patients with primary hyperaldosteronism generally do not respond to antihypertensive drugs acting via blockade of the renin-angiotensin system. Therefore, telmisartan is not recommended for these patients.
Aortic and mitral valve stenosis, obstructive hypertrophic cardiomyopathy.
As with other vasodilators, telmisartan should be used with caution in patients diagnosed with aortic or mitral valve stenosis or obstructive hypertrophic cardiomyopathy.
Diabetic patients treated with insulin or antidiabetic medicinal products.
Hypoglycaemia may occur during treatment with telmisartan in such patients. Blood glucose levels should be monitored in these patients, and this should be considered when adjusting the dose of insulin or antidiabetic agents.
In patients with diabetes and cardiovascular risk (patients with diabetes and concomitant coronary artery disease), the risk of fatal myocardial infarction and sudden cardiovascular death may be higher when treated with antihypertensive agents such as angiotensin II receptor antagonists and ACE inhibitors. Coronary artery disease in diabetic patients may be asymptomatic and therefore undiagnosed. Diabetic patients should be carefully evaluated, e.g., by stress testing, to detect and treat concomitant coronary artery disease before initiating treatment with this medicinal product.
Hyperkalaemia. Medicinal products affecting the renin-angiotensin-aldosterone system may cause hyperkalaemia.
In elderly patients, patients with renal impairment, diabetic patients, patients receiving other medicinal products that may increase potassium levels, and/or patients with concomitant diseases, hyperkalaemia may lead to fatal outcomes.
The benefit-risk ratio must be carefully considered before combining medicinal products that inhibit the renin-angiotensin system.
Key risk factors for hyperkalaemia to consider include:
- diabetes mellitus, renal impairment, age ≥70 years;
- combination therapy with one or more other agents affecting the renin-angiotensin-aldosterone system, and/or potassium-containing dietary supplements. Medicinal products or therapeutic groups that may provoke hyperkalaemia include potassium-containing salt substitutes, potassium-sparing diuretics, ACE inhibitors, angiotensin II receptor antagonists, non-steroidal anti-inflammatory drugs (NSAIDs, including selective COX-2 inhibitors), heparin, immunosuppressants (cyclosporine or tacrolimus), and trimethoprim;
- intercurrent events, particularly dehydration, acute heart decompensation, metabolic acidosis, worsening renal function, acute worsening of kidney function (e.g., due to infections), and cellular lysis (e.g., acute limb ischaemia, acute skeletal muscle necrosis, extensive trauma).
Patients at risk require close monitoring of serum potassium concentration (see section "Interaction with other medicinal products and other forms of interaction").
Ethnic differences. As with all other angiotensin II receptor antagonists, telmisartan is less effective in reducing blood pressure in black patients compared to patients of other races. This may be explained by the higher prevalence of low-renin states in black patients with arterial hypertension.
Other. As with other antihypertensive agents, excessive reduction of blood pressure in patients with ischaemic heart disease or ischaemic cardiomyopathy may lead to myocardial infarction or stroke.
Mannitol.
The medicinal product contains mannitol. Patients with rare hereditary fructose intolerance should not take this medicinal product.
Sodium.
Each tablet contains less than 1 mmol sodium (23 mg), which is considered essentially "sodium-free".
Use during pregnancy or breastfeeding.
Pregnancy.
The medicinal product is contraindicated in pregnant women or women planning to become pregnant. If pregnancy is confirmed during treatment with this medicinal product, treatment must be discontinued immediately and, if necessary, replaced with another medicinal product approved for use during pregnancy (see sections "Contraindications" and "Special precautions for use").
There are no adequate data on the use of telmisartan in pregnant women.
Epidemiological evidence for teratogenic risk associated with ACE inhibitors during the first trimester of pregnancy has not been convincing, but a small increased risk cannot be excluded. Although there are no controlled epidemiological data on teratogenic risk with angiotensin II receptor antagonists, similar risks may exist for this class of medicinal products. When pregnancy is planned, the medicinal product should be replaced in advance with another antihypertensive agent with an established safety profile during pregnancy. Angiotensin II receptor antagonists must be discontinued immediately upon confirmation of pregnancy, and alternative treatment initiated if necessary.
It is known that use of angiotensin II receptor antagonists during the second and third trimesters of pregnancy causes foetal toxicity in humans (renal dysfunction, oligohydramnios, delayed skull ossification) and neonatal toxicity (renal failure, hypotension, hyperkalaemia). If angiotensin II receptor antagonists are used from the second trimester of pregnancy, ultrasound monitoring of foetal renal function and skull ossification is recommended. Neonates whose mothers were treated with angiotensin II receptor antagonists must be closely monitored for hypotension (see sections "Contraindications" and "Special precautions for use").
Breastfeeding.
Due to lack of information on the use of telmisartan during breastfeeding, this medicinal product is not recommended for use in breastfeeding women. Alternative treatment with a better-established safety profile is preferred, especially when breastfeeding a newborn or preterm infant.
Fertility.
Preclinical studies have not shown any effect of telmisartan on fertility in males or females.
Effects on ability to drive and use machines.
When driving or operating machinery, the possibility of dizziness or hypersomnia associated with antihypertensive therapy, including telmisartan, should be taken into account.
Dosage and Administration
Arterial Hypertension Treatment
The usual effective dose of telmisartan is 40 mg once daily. Some patients may achieve adequate blood pressure control with a daily dose of 20 mg telmisartan. If blood pressure is not adequately controlled, the dose of telmisartan may be increased to 80 mg once daily. Alternatively, telmisartan can be administered in combination with thiazide diuretics such as hydrochlorothiazide, which provide additional antihypertensive effects when used with telmisartan. When considering dose escalation, it should be noted that the maximal antihypertensive effect is achieved within 4–8 weeks of initiating treatment.
Prevention of Cardiovascular Disease
The recommended dose is 80 mg once daily. The efficacy of telmisartan at doses lower than 80 mg for cardiovascular disease prevention is unknown.
When initiating telmisartan treatment for the purpose of reducing cardiovascular risk, careful monitoring of blood pressure is recommended, and dose adjustments of other antihypertensive medications may be necessary.
Special Patient Groups
Renal Impairment. Experience with telmisartan in patients with renal insufficiency or those undergoing hemodialysis is limited. These patients should be started on the lowest initial dose of telmisartan, 20 mg (see section "Special Warnings and Precautions for Use"). Dose adjustment is not required in patients with mild to moderate renal impairment.
Hepatic Impairment. Telmisartan is contraindicated in patients with severe hepatic impairment.
In patients with mild to moderate hepatic impairment, the daily dose of telmisartan should not exceed 40 mg once daily (see section "Special Warnings and Precautions for Use").
Elderly Patients. Dose adjustment is not required.
Administration Method
TELNOR should be taken orally once daily with sufficient fluid, independent of food intake.
Tablets should be stored in the sealed blister pack to protect from moisture. Tablets should be removed from the blister immediately before administration.
Children
The safety and efficacy of TELNOR in children (under 18 years of age) have not been established.
Overdose
Information on overdose is limited.
Symptoms. The most prominent symptoms of telmisartan overdose were hypotension and tachycardia; bradycardia, dizziness, increased serum creatinine concentration, and acute renal failure have also been reported.
Treatment. Telmisartan is not removed from the body by hemodialysis. Patients should be closely monitored and receive symptomatic and supportive treatment. Management depends on the time since overdose and the severity of symptoms. Induction of emesis and/or gastric lavage may be considered. Activated charcoal may be used in the management of overdose. Serum electrolytes and creatinine levels should be monitored frequently. In case of arterial hypotension, the patient should be placed in a supine position and treated with measures aimed at rapid restoration of fluid and electrolyte volume.
Adverse Reactions
Serious adverse reactions, including anaphylactic reaction and angioedema, may occur in individual cases (frequency from ≥ 1/10,000 to <1/1,000), and acute renal failure has also been observed.
The overall frequency of adverse reactions in patients with arterial hypertension during controlled clinical trials was generally comparable between telmisartan and placebo (41.4% vs. 43.9%). The frequency of adverse reactions was independent of dose, patient sex, age, or race. The safety profile of telmisartan in patients treated for cardiovascular disease prevention corresponds to the safety profile observed in patients with arterial hypertension.
Adverse reactions are listed according to their frequency: very common (≥1/10); common (from 1/100 to <1/10); uncommon (from 1/1,000 to <1/100); rare (from 1/10,000 to <1/1,000); very rare (<1/10,000).
Within each category, adverse reactions are listed in order of decreasing severity.
Infections and infestations:
Uncommon – urinary tract infections (including cystitis), upper respiratory tract infections (including pharyngitis and sinusitis);
Rare – sepsis, including fatal cases1.
Blood and lymphatic system disorders:
Uncommon – anaemia;
Rare – eosinophilia, thrombocytopenia.
Immune system disorders:
Rare – anaphylactic reaction, hypersensitivity.
Metabolism and nutrition disorders:
Uncommon – hyperkalaemia;
Rare – hypoglycaemia (in patients with diabetes mellitus).
Psychiatric disorders:
Uncommon – insomnia, depression;
Rare – anxiety.
Nervous system disorders:
Uncommon – syncope;
Rare – somnolence.
Eye disorders:
Rare – visual disturbance.
Ear and labyrinth disorders:
Uncommon – vertigo.
Cardiac disorders:
Uncommon – bradycardia;
Rare – tachycardia.
Vascular disorders:
Uncommon – arterial hypotension2, orthostatic hypotension.
Respiratory, thoracic and mediastinal disorders:
Uncommon – dyspnoea, cough;
Very rare – interstitial lung disease4.
Gastrointestinal disorders:
Uncommon – abdominal pain, diarrhoea, dyspepsia, flatulence, vomiting;
Rare – dry mouth, epigastric discomfort, dysgeusia.
Hepatobiliary disorders:
Rare – liver function abnormalities/liver disorders3.
Skin and subcutaneous tissue disorders:
Uncommon – pruritus, increased sweating, rash;
Rare – angioedema (including fatal cases), eczema, erythema, urticaria, drug eruption, toxic dermatitis.
Musculoskeletal and connective tissue disorders:
Uncommon – back pain (e.g. sciatica), muscle cramps, myalgia;
Rare – arthralgia, limb pain, tendon pain (symptoms similar to tendinitis).
Renal and urinary disorders:
Uncommon – renal dysfunction, including acute renal failure.
General disorders and administration site conditions:
Uncommon – chest pain, asthenia (weakness);
Rare – influenza-like symptoms.
Investigations:
Uncommon – increased blood creatinine;
Rare – decreased haemoglobin levels, increased blood uric acid, increased liver enzymes, increased blood creatine phosphokinase.
1, 2, 3, 4 – See section "Adverse Reactions. Description of selected adverse reactions".
Description of selected adverse reactions
Sepsis. In the PRoFESS study, a higher incidence of sepsis was observed among patients receiving telmisartan compared to those receiving placebo. This may be due to chance or may reflect an underlying process not yet understood.
Arterial hypotension. This adverse reaction was observed commonly in patients with controlled blood pressure who received telmisartan for cardiovascular risk reduction in addition to standard therapy.
Liver function abnormalities/liver disorders. According to post-marketing data, most cases of liver function abnormalities/liver disorders occurred in patients of Japanese nationality. These patients may be more susceptible to these adverse reactions.
Interstitial lung disease. Cases of interstitial lung disease have been temporally associated with telmisartan use during post-marketing surveillance. However, a causal relationship has not been established.

Shelf life. 3 years.
Storage conditions. Store in the original packaging at a temperature not exceeding 25 °C, in a place inaccessible to children.
Packaging. 10 tablets per blister, 1 or 3 blisters per cardboard box.
Prescription status. Prescription only.
